New shuttle service to provide enhanced local travel options

Posted on February 24, 2017 at 5:23 pm by Nicole Acker

By: Nick Yee

Starting, Monday, March 6, the Midday shuttle will expand to two new routes. Both routes will continue to be free and open to all. The 20-passenger busses are wheelchair-accessible and have a bicycle rack. The new service will provide better Caltrain connections and provide another travel option to residents, especially during upcoming construction in the area. 

Route M1-Menlo Midday (blue line) will run Monday through Friday, 9:30am-3:00pm, covering the Menlo Park to Palo Alto portion of the current Midday route. Destinations include downtown Menlo Park, Sharon Heights Shopping Center, Stanford Medical Center, Stanford Shopping Center, Palo Alto Medical Foundation, and downtown Palo Alto.

Route M2-Belle Haven (red line) will run Monday through Friday, 6:30am-5:00pm, covering the Senior Center to downtown portion of the current Midday route. Destinations include the Senior Center, VA Medical Center, Menlo Medical Clinics, Library and Burgess Park, Menlo-Atherton High School, Caltrain station, Crane Place, downtown Menlo Park, and Little House.
